Transaction 5573504150ef4efed76f847410318a50d39fdfd42b7f21273e19d838ea03328c
1 Input
2 Outputs
- 5573504150ef4efed76f847410318a50d39fdfd42b7f21273e19d838ea03328c:0
- 5573504150ef4efed76f847410318a50d39fdfd42b7f21273e19d838ea03328c:1
value 4350000
address 1HwUCuXd64DyroKjbvEJcvYKUss2dpAKae
value 59482846
address 1LkgTJTFuTETS1Y672hCrZY7H6nndaeeSH